Originally released in 2015 for PlayStation, Xbox, and PC, Resident Evil Revelations 2 was designed as a mid-tier title bridging the gap between the action-heavy Resident Evil 5/6 and the return to roots seen in Resident Evil 7 . The game is episodic in structure, split into four main chapters plus two bonus episodes.

Resident Evil Revelations 2 on Nintendo Switch is a survival-horror title featuring the interwoven stories of series veterans Claire Redfield and Barry Burton. Originally released in an episodic format in 2015, the Switch version (released November 28, 2017) bundles all four main episodes and additional story DLC into a single package.
